Note that the physical volume size equals the virtual drive size from the MegaCli64 output. There's a single
volume group created on /dev/sda2 called VGExaDB :
[root@cm01dbm01 ~]# vgdisplay | egrep '(VG Name|Alloc PE|Free PE)'
VG Name VGExaDb
Alloc PE / Size 39424 / 154.00 GB
Free PE / Size 103327 / 403.62 GB
[root@cm01dbm01 ~]#
As you can see, there is approximately 400 GB of free space on the volume group. An lvdisplay shows the swap
partition, LVDbSys1 , and LVDbOra1 , mounted to / and /u01 , respectively:
